Stefan Monnier writes:
> At least it doesn't seem "obviously correct" to me: what if the user
> opens up an X frame after starting "emacs -nw"?

The hang arises when emacs is started without an X server present or at
least with DISPLAY not set.  I don't see how a user would be able to
open an X frame at a later point in time in that situation (or
reasonable expect he might be able to).
